  • Abstract
    The results of the investigation of a cylinder shell loaded by a concentrated force normal to the surface are presented. The triple-exposure in-focus image method of holographic interferometry was utilized to obtain holographic interferograms and speckle-photographs which then were used to identify three components of the displacement vector on the illuminated surface. Approximating (on a personal computer) the discrete identified values of the displacements by polynomials of high degree (5 or 6) and using known differential relations of the classical theory of shallow shells, we defined the strains on the illuminated surface of a cylindrical shell. Then the calculations for the separation of the bending and membrane strains were performed to determine the stress-strain state in the shell under investigation.
